With heavy hearts after an unimaginable loss, we announce the passing of our beloved parents, Darik Peter Watt and Michelle Marie Paternoster Watt. After a valiant fight with pancreatic cancer, Darik peacefully passed away in the early afternoon on Sep 1, 2026. Unexpectedly, the love of his life, Michelle, also passed away that day.

Darik Peter Watt was born on November 22, 1966 in Oakland, CA to Peter and Virginia “June” Watt. At age 5, his family moved to Boise, ID. He attended Capital High School and had the privilege of playing the trumpet in the Capital High Golden Eagles Marching Band, sparking a love of music he had for the rest of his life. He was awarded a scholarship to continue his schooling at Boise State University in their music department and had the honor of playing in the inaugural season of the Keith Stein Blue Thunder Marching Band in 1987. After his schooling, he went on to spend the majority of his career working for Hewlett-Packard.

Michelle Marie Watt was born on December 21, 1966 in Boise, ID to Terrance “Terry” and Dee Paternoster. She came home from the hospital on Christmas Eve, making her the best Christmas present her parents ever received. She attended Boise High, where she was a member of the drill team. After graduation, she took jobs in New York and Utah, before ultimately returning home to Boise to also attend Boise State University. She would later go on to enjoy a long career working for the State of Idaho at the Department of Labor.

After meeting on a double date, Darik and Michelle were immediately inseparable. They were married in Darik’s grandparent’s backyard on April 9th, 1988. Soon thereafter, they were thrilled to welcome their son, Jaryn, into the world in September of 1990. On June 8th, 1991, the three of them were sealed together for time and all eternity in the Boise Idaho LDS Temple. The family grew in the years that followed, with two daughters, Hailey (1993) and Karyssa (1994), completing their family. After a short time in Northwest Boise, the Watt Family settled in Meridian where they raised their family.

Family was always at the center of their lives, and becoming grandparents later on gave them a whole new sense of purpose and fulfillment. Only the love for each other and the Lord meant more to them than their relationships with family and friends.

They are survived by their three children: Jaryn (Caity), Hailey (Dallin), and Karyssa (Tyler); seven grandchildren; Darik’s brothers: Deran (Tracy) and Mark; Michelle’s parents: Terry and Dee; Michelle’s siblings: Terrance Jr. (Lisa), Brett (Colleen), Ryan (Carrie), Rhonda (Chris), Erik (Marcie), and Katie (Carl).
